Training your Labrador Retriever is not only essential for their well-being but also crucial for building a strong bond with your furry friend. Labs are intelligent and eager to please, making them relatively easy to train with the right approach. Let's delve into the different aspects of training and how to create a well-behaved and happy Lab. First, **Start Early**. Begin training your Lab as soon as you bring them home. Even young puppies can learn basic commands like sit, stay, and come. Early training will set the foundation for a well-behaved dog. Second, **Positive Reinforcement**. Use positive reinforcement methods, such as praise, treats, and toys, to reward desired behaviors. Avoid punishment, as it can damage your relationship and make your dog fearful. Third, **Consistency**. Be consistent with your commands and expectations. Use the same words and hand signals every time. Everyone in the family should be on the same page. Fourth, **Short and Fun Sessions**. Keep training sessions short, fun, and engaging. Dogs learn best when they're having fun. If your dog is getting bored or distracted, end the session and try again later. Fifth, **Socialization**. Expose your Lab to different people, places, and experiences from a young age. This will help them become well-adjusted and confident dogs. Enroll your Lab in obedience classes. Professional trainers can provide guidance and help you address any behavioral issues. Consider advanced training classes. Once your Lab has mastered basic obedience, you can explore advanced training options, such as agility, flyball, or scent work. Labs can be incredibly versatile! Labs thrive on mental stimulation. Provide them with puzzle toys or interactive games to keep them entertained and prevent boredom.
